Kwara Court Grants Singer Portable ₦1Million Bail In Saheed Osupa Defamation Case
Controversial Nigerian singer, Habeeb Okikiola Badmus, popularly known as Portable, has been granted bail in the sum of ₦1 million by an Upper Area Court in Ilorin, Kwara State.
This followed his arraignment on charges including criminal defamation, intimidation, inciting public disturbance, and cyberstalking.
According to the court, the bail is conditional upon the provision of two sureties in like sum. One must be either the Chairman or Secretary of the Performing Musicians Association of Nigeria (PMAN), while the other must possess a landed property within a Government Reserved Area (GRA), backed by a valid Certificate of Occupancy (C of O).
The case, documented under First Information Report (FIR) 117(1) CPC, was filed by the State Intelligence Department of the Nigeria police following a petition dated March 21, 2025, by fellow artist Okunola Saheed Osupa, aka Osupa.
According to the petition, Portable on March 19, 2025, made a live broadcast on Instagram, where he allegedly defamed Osupa, claiming the complainant was envious of his success and attempting to destroy his reputation.
In the video, Portable was quoted to have said: “This man dey try bring down my shine! He be like person wey dey chop snail with shell—him no get sense. Osupa na tortoise. When Apple Music and Spotify wan drop money for me, na him remove my song from platform make I no see money (This man is trying to dim my shine! He behaves like someone eating a snail with the shell—he lacks sense. Osupa is like a tortoise. When Apple Music and Spotify were about to pay me, he took down my song from the platforms so I wouldn’t get the money).”
The complainant, Osupa, maintained in his statement that Portable’s remarks were not only defamatory and damaging but also intended to incite public hatred and disturb the peace. Upon interrogation at the State Intelligence Department (SID), Ilorin, Portable reportedly confessed to the allegations, police said.
The accused was arraigned under several legal provisions: Section 392 (Criminal Defamation), Section 114 (Inciting Disturbance), Section 397 (Criminal Intimidation) of the Penal Code.
Section 24(1)(b) and 24(2)(c) of the Cybercrimes (Prohibition, Prevention, etc.) Act, 2015, Sections 10 and 13 of the Violence Against Persons (Prohibition) Law, 2020.
The Investigating Police Officer, ASP Adeniyi James, confirmed that Portable was charged based on a directive from the police authorities.
Portable, a native of Oke-Osa in Sango-Ota, Ogun State, is expected to fulfil his bail conditions before being released. The case has been adjourned, with the presiding judge urging all parties to maintain decorum as proceedings continue. https://saharareporters.com/2025/04/14/breaking-kwara-court-grants-singer-portable-n1million-bail-saheed-osupa-defamation-case

"No going back on blasphemy laws” Kano State Government tells ECOWAS court. The Kano State Government has defended its blasphemy laws against a verdict by the ECOWAS Court of Justice, asserting the constitutional right to uphold religious sanctity within its jurisdiction. Earlier ECOWAS Court Orders Nigeria To Amend Kano’s Blasphemy Laws which criminalized acts deemed insulting to religion, with Section 210 criticized for its vague definition of what constitutes an insult and Section 382(b) imposing the death penalty for insulting the Prophet Muhammad.
